Output 669304e8f1098a4e16dc82450effe349ec54b4dd9c73b41f9222ef856eab7295:0

value
165620335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29087afddfd59c00777addd8d04040d12dfba300 OP_EQUAL
address
MBe86XUfG9JzwDddvHsmGKyErLQw1WPfre
transaction
669304e8f1098a4e16dc82450effe349ec54b4dd9c73b41f9222ef856eab7295
spent
true